The comments from Yaramaz about a pilates instructor being hired at Berlitz was pretty funny....and is of concern, especially in view of the fact that Berlitz is one of the most (if not themost expensive language schools to study a foreign language) expensive schools for foreign language study.
The good thing about Berlitz, is that if they like you and you do a good job, you will be treated pretty well, and can work there for the long term.
Also the Berlitz 'name' despite the naysayers, still carries weight and prestige.
Ghost has friends who work for Berlitz, Montreal, who have been there for years. That says a lot about a language school. It is all a question of 'fit' and whether you can conform to their regimented lesson structure (the Berlitz way). If you can adapt, good, if not, you might not be happy.
